Business Support Officer
RPS is a global professional services firm that defines, designs, and manages projects while solving problems that matter to a complex, urbanising, and resource-scarce world. We have an exciting full-time opportunity available for a Business Support Officer (BSO) to join our team based in Canberra. This position will be responsible for providing administration support to our Canberra Office.
ABOUT THE ROLE
- Providing administrative support to the Canberra office, ensuring quality and accuracy, whilst ensuring deadlines are met
- Arrange travel and accommodation for staff as required
- Handle incoming calls and correspondence and actioning or responding as appropriate
- Undertaking general business support and administrative tasks including typing, formatting and proofreading of documents, minute taking, filing and archiving, using approved systems and templates
- Supporting staff to facilitate the timely preparation, approval and issuing of invoices, reports, claims and other submissions
- Coordinating and assisting with the preparation of fee proposals, tenders and similar submissions
- Ordering Personal Protective Equipment and co-ordinating ordering of stationery and other office supplies
- Assist with co-ordination of equipment for new starters and ICT replacements
- Assisting with logging Vendor invoices and Staff expense and mileage claims
- Other duties as directed
- 2-3 years' experience in project administration, office administration or business support roles
- Previous experience as an office administrator, secretary, personal or executive assistant (desirable)
- Intermediate to Advanced Microsoft Office and SharePoint
- Demonstrated ability to produce quality and accurate work
- Demonstrated ability to deliver quality work unsupervised
